Posted: January 19th, 2009 | Author: Márcio Gasparotto | Filed under: Dicas, ruby on rails | Comente! »

O Carlos Bandro liberou a versão em português do livro Ruby on Rails 2.2 – o que há de novo? para download, “di grátis”, isso mesmo free!
Eu já tinha adquirido o mesmo na data do lançamento junto com o screencast, e até ja tinha dado a dica aqui mesmo.
Parabéns Carlos pela iniciativa!
Link para download
Link do post no blog do Carlos
Abraço!
Posted: November 26th, 2008 | Author: Márcio Gasparotto | Filed under: Dicas, ruby on rails | Tags: dica, jrails, ruby on rails | Comente! »
No rails 2.2 foi adicionado um novo helper para os templates .rjs o reload, pra quem assim como eu, usa o jrails para trocar o prototype pelo jquery fica essa dica, pois até o momento pessoal do jrails não atualizou o mesmo, portanto se você chamar o page.reload usando o jrails vai quebrar.
Para solucionar o problema é simples, basta incluir o codigo abaixo no arquivo jrails.rb (vendor/plugins/jrails/lib/jrails.rb) dentro da Classe JavaScriptGenerator e do Módulo GeneratorMethods.
Abraço!
Posted: October 27th, 2008 | Author: Márcio Gasparotto | Filed under: Dicas, ruby on rails | Tags: livro, ruby on rails | 2 Comentários »

Acabei de adquirir o livro Ruby on Rails 2.2 – O que há de novo, e aproveito para parabenizar o Carlos Brando, pelo excelente trabalho. Parabéns Carlos!
Só li umas 15 ou 20 páginas ainda, mas já vi muita coisa legal, como especificar conditions usando hash e as mudanças no método validates_length_of.
Fica aqui a dica, comprei o pacote contendo o livro e o screencast por $16,00. Na cotação de hoje saiu por apenas R$36,80 o que acho que é até um valor simbólico pela qualidade e importância do conteúdo.
Posted: August 21st, 2008 | Author: Márcio Gasparotto | Filed under: Dicas, ruby on rails | Tags: Dicas, ruby on rails | 2 Comentários »
Essa é bem simples, coisa básica, mas que uso sempre.
Praticamente todas aplicações tem tabelas em que uma das colunas é usada para setar o status/situação do registro, eu costumo gerar esses campos através de migrates assim: status:boolean, na hora de exibir esse registro ao usuário precisamos tratá-lo, pois mostrar true ou false convenhamos que não é legal.
Seguindo o principio de DRY do rails a solução é bem simples.
No application_helper.rb coloco a seguinte função:
Na view basta usar assim:
A explicação é bem simples, a função ativo_inativo recebe um parâmetro true ou false e através de um operador ternário devolve Ativo ou Inativo, lembre-se a função agora está disponivel para toda a aplicação, sem repetições.
Abraço!
Posted: August 21st, 2008 | Author: Márcio Gasparotto | Filed under: Dicas, MySql | Tags: Dicas, MySql | Comente! »
Navegando pela web esses dias dei de cara com um aplicativo web para administração do MySql o SQL Buddy, acho que todo desenvolvedor conhece o phpMyAdmin ele realmente é uma mão na roda quando precisamos administrar algo no MySql de forma remota, porém eu acho a interface do phpMyAdmin meio confusa e muita vezes acho que a velocidade deixa muito a desejar.
O SQL Buddy é um Web based MySQL administration que foca na simplicidade e na velocidade, pra isso ele usa ajax para as requisições tornando assim a interface e usabilidade do mesmo bem agradáveis.
A simplicidade da instalação também chama a atenção, é bem no estilo rails, pois basta descompactar o mesmo em um diretório e pronto, é claro que tem que estar com o php rodando. Vale lembrar que tem suporte a temas e ainda já tem tradução para português. A dica está dada!
